Answer:
Pr(blue) = 2/7
Step-by-step explanation:
Blue = 6
White = 7
Gray = 8
Total socks = 6+7+8 =21
Probability of picking blue = number of blue ➗ total number of socks
Pr(blue) = 6/21
Divide both by 3 to make the fraction to the lowest term.
Pr(blue) = 2/7
